Watson & DeepMind: Genius or Gimmick?
IBM Watson, launched with the promise of revolutionizing industries through smart analytics, once stunned audiences worldwide by outmaneuvering human intellect in Jeopardy! This victory was heralded as a triumph of artificial over natural intelligence—a fusion of computational speed with a mastery of language and trivia. However, years later, the application of Watson has been relegated to more specialized domains, such as healthcare, where its successes are mixed and often disputed within the respective professional communities. The genius of Watson, with its purportedly vast mathematical and cognitive abilities, appears partially obscured behind curtains of commercial interests and proprietary secrecy.
Google DeepMind, on the other hand, dazzled the world with its mastery of Go through AlphaGo, unraveling the intricacies of one of the oldest board games with apparent ease. The victory against human champions was no mere flavor of the week—it signified a seismic shift in machine learning, a testament to the application of neural networks and reinforcement learning, two techniques deeply enmeshed with mathematical expertise. And yet, despite the impressive facade, the everyday utility of such technology is challenged by critiques who argue that such demonstrations do little to alleviate pressing global issues. They posit that the spotlight on DeepMind’s achievements overshadows the substantive, transformative applications of AI that should be championed instead.
